I don't think it can work that way. OpenMAX can only define a user-level API, not a kernel-level API. We can extend v4l2 in ways to make it easier to implement OpenMAX libraries on top of it, but there is not going to be a duplication of kernel interfaces for the sake of following a specific API in the upstream kernel. > > It might be that some alignment also needs to be made between 4vl2 and > > other OS's implementation, to ease developing drivers for many OSs > > (sorry I don't know these details, but you ST-E guys should know). > > The basic conflict I would say is that Linux has its own API+ABI, which > is defined by V4L and ALSA through a community process without much > thought about any existing standard APIs. Some people would argue that on the contrary, the standard was written without an understanding of reality and existing practice if it tries to specify a kernel-level ABI ;-) This has happened a lot before, and it generally doesn't help the adoption of those standards. > This coupled with strict delivery deadlines and a marketing will > to state conformance to OpenMAX of course leads companies into > solutions breaking the Linux kernelspace API to be able to present > this. > > Now I think we have a pretty clear view of the problem, I don't > know what could be done about it though :-/ We can't stop anyone from shipping incompatible kernels, but we can help the Linaro members understand the problem. If the goal is to state OpenMAX conformance, it would certainly be a good idea to have people work on providing a hardware-independent OpenMAX IL implementation on top of V4L2 and make sure it works with all the devices.
